Population over time in Glendale Heights

Year Population % Change
2020 33,863 -1.2%
2019 34,280 -0.1%
2018 34,330 -0.2%
2017 34,395 -0.3%
2016 34,497 0.2%
2015 34,436 0.2%
2014 34,351 0.6%
2013 34,159 0.8%
2012 33,898 0.7%
2011 33,664 -

Race Glendale Heights IL USA
White 30.7% 60.8% 60.1%
African American 11.9% 13.9% 12.2%
American Indian 0.1% 0.1% 0.6%
Asian 22.7% 5.5% 5.6%
Hawaiian 0.1% 0.0% 0.2%
Other 0.9% 0.2% 0.3%
Two Or More 2.9% 2.2% 2.8%
Hispanic 30.5% 17.2% 18.2%
